Issues Accessing Banking and Secure Apps Over Sky Broadband
Dear Sky Support,
I hope you’re well.
I’m currently experiencing issues accessing several banking and secure applications when connected to my Sky Broadband network. These apps work perfectly when using mobile data, but they fail to load or return security-related error messages (such as VPN or bot usage warnings) when connected to my home Wi-Fi.
This suggests that there may be restrictions or filtering mechanisms in place on my broadband connection — possibly related to DNS settings, content filtering (such as Broadband Shield), or the external IP address assigned to my connection.

Re: Issues Accessing Banking and Secure Apps Over Sky Broadband
@iyazeedi wrote:
Could you please assist by:
- Verifying whether there are any filters or restrictions enabled on my broadband service.
- Disabling any content filtering, if active.
- Providing a new external IP address, if possible, in case the current one is flagged.
Posting in this forum doesn't get your issue to Sky support. Sky Broadband Shield is under your own control, and a different IP address may be obtainable by switching your Hub off for one hour.
